What is a Ledger?

A ledger is the main or principal book of accounts used for recording accounting transactions.  It is the most important book of accounts that are kept by all organizations. It is also the final destination of all transactions recorded in the journal.

It is also called the book of final entry because the transactions which are first entered in journal or subsidiary books are finally incorporated in the ledger.

In the ledger, transactions are recorded using the double-entry system.
